Fay is an online platform that gives Americans access to Registered Dietitians through their insurance and empowers dietitians to build private practices with Fay’s AI-powered tools. Pulse 2.0 interviewed Fay co-founder and CEO Sam Faycurry to learn more about the company.

Formation Of Fay

How did the idea for Fay come together? Faycurry said:

“Prior to starting my MBA at Harvard Business School, I was helping my mom and sister, both registered dietitians, navigate the challenging task of launching their private practice. I quickly learned how difficult it was for many dietitians like my mom and sister to open private practices and navigate the complexities of accepting insurance, despite the large number of people in need of affordable, personal nutrition therapy.”

“Through the process of helping them, it became clear to me how big of an opportunity there was to help both clients and providers. By making nutrition therapy more affordable and accessible we had the potential to help millions of people live longer, healthier, happier lives. And by creating a seamless way for providers to start and run a thriving private practice, we had the potential to empower an entire industry of providers who have been historically underappreciated and undervalued. I was enthralled by the potential impact we could make and felt I had no other choice but to pursue creating Fay!”

Core Products

What are the company’s core products and features? Faycurry explained:

“Fay connects individuals with registered dietitian nutritionists to deliver personalized nutrition counseling care, covered by insurance.”

“For clients, they can visit the Fay website to choose a dietitian that fits their needs and accepts their insurance. They will then meet 1:1 with their dietitian who will design a personalized plan that is catered to their needs.”

“For dietitians, Fay provides them with a full-suite “business in a box” to make it seamless for them to start and scale their private practice. This includes insurance credentialing, an easy-to-use platform to run their practice and marketing.”

Challenges Faced

What challenges have Faycurry and the team faced in building the company? Faycurry acknowledged:

“Fay’s services come at a pivotal point for the U.S. health landscape, where over half of U.S. adults struggle with diet-related chronic conditions, with many more in dire need of preventative care. Despite the urgent need for intervention, there remains a lack of awareness about insurance coverage for medical nutrition therapy provided by RDs. Most plans don’t require a certain diagnosis or physician referral, and the benefits of nutrition counseling apply to prevention and management of health conditions.”

“Fay’s mission has been to break down these barriers so that people can access life-changing nutrition and ultimately live longer healthier lives. This has been Fay’s mission all along, but the company has made major strides in 2023 to make this a reality.”

“Fay has revolutionized the field of dietetics by making nutrition therapy affordable and accessible to the majority of Americans.”

  1. Fay has worked with insurance companies to champion the benefits of nutrition therapy for the prevention and management of health conditions, with over 700 insurance plans now accepting nutrition therapy as a covered benefit. Therefore, the majority of individuals with insurance will now pay as little as $0 for their sessions.
  2. Fay created a “business in a box” for Registered Dietitians to make it seamless for providers to start and scale their independent private practices. Dietitians now spend less time on tedious tasks such as insurance reimbursements and customer acquisition, and focus more on providing life-changing care.

Significant Milestones

What have been some of the company’s most significant milestones? Faycurry cited:

“I’m proud that Fay has achieved the following milestones:

  1. Fay has amassed the largest and fastest-growing network of Registered Dietitians in the country, with over 1,000 providers. That number expected to double by 2025.
  2. Fay has helped tens of thousands of patients receive life-changing care.
  3. Fay accepts over 700 insurance plans, so 95% of people with insurance will pay as little as $0.
